Claims
- 1. A method for fabricating an isolating structure for MOS and bipolar circuits, comprising the steps of:
- forming a shallow recess in a semiconductor substrate;
- forming a deep trench in the semiconductor substrate, said deep trench having a surface area substantially the same as a surface area of said shallow recess, said deep trench having a stepped sidewall so that an upper portion of said trench has a width greater than a lower portion of said trench, wherein said lower trench portion is formed, and wherein said upper portion of said trench is formed simultaneously with said shallow recess;
- forming a thin insulation on the surface of said recess and said deep trench; and
- filling said recess and said deep trench with a polysilicon material.
- 2. The method of claim 1, further including forming said deep trench about eight microns deep and forming said recess about a 0.8 micron deep.
- 3. The method of claim 1, further including forming a pair of bipolar transistors isolated by said deep trench, and forming a CMOS transistor pair isolated by said recess.
- 4. The method of claim 1, further including forming a conductor overlying an elongated portion of one of said recess or said deep trench for reducing a capacitance between said conductor and said substrate.
- 5. The method of claim 1, further including forming the thin insulation by oxidizing the semiconductor substrate.
- 6. The method of claim 1, further including forming a PMOS transistor isolated by said isolating structure from an NMOS transistor.
- 7. The method of claim 1, further including forming said recess with essentially vertical sidewalls so as to reduce lateral extensions of said isolating structure.
- 8. The method of claim 7, further including forming said recess by utilizing an anisotropic etch.
- 9. A method for fabricating an isolating structure for MOS and bipolar circuits, comprising the steps of:
- forming a layer of silicon oxide on a semiconductor substrate;
- forming a layer of non-oxidizing dielectric material over said silicon oxide and patterning said dielectric material to define a shallow recess location and a deep trench location in said substrate;
- masking said substrate with a material to form openings in alignment with said trench location;
- etching said substrate to remove said silicon oxide at said trench location and said semiconductor substrate material to form said deep trench;
- removing said masking material and etching said substrate through said dielectric opening to form said recess and to extend a depth of said trench, wherein said recess is etched with a different lateral dimension than that of a lower portion of said deep trench;
- oxidizing the trench surfaces ad the recess surfaces to form an oxide insulation; and
- filling said deep trench and said recess with a nonconductive material.
- 10. The method of claim 9, further including forming said deep trench with a stepped sidewall so that an upper portion of said trench has a width greater than a lower portion of said trench.
- 11. The method of claim 9, further including simultaneously oxidizing said recess and said deep trench, and simultaneously filling said recess and said deep trench with a polysilicon material.
